Hockey Gangpur emerge champions

Post News Network

Bhubaneswar, May 5: Hockey Gangpur edged past Hockey Patiala 2-1 in the final to emerge champions of the Vth Hockey India Junior Women’s Hockey Championship (Div-B) at Rajnandgoan of Chhattisgarh, Tuesday. With the title win, Gangpur qualified for division-A.

Rinki Kujur drew the first blood as early as the sixth minute of the match by converting a penalty corner. In form Janhabi Pradhan nailed a brilliant field goal in the 23rd minute to double the lead. Hockey Patiala got one back in the 60th minute through Manpreet. They tried their best to restore parity throughout the match, but their effort was foiled by a resolute defense of Gangpur. Chief coach Amulya Nanda Bihari expressed satisfaction over the performance of the team.
